TeamViewer는 어떤 프로토콜을 사용합니까?


12

나는 단지 누군가에게 SSH & VNC에 대해 조금 가르치고 있었다. TeamViewer로 몇 가지를 보여줄 것이라고 말했습니다. 그리고는 나에게 "김이 ..이 VNC 클라이언트입니다 물어?
그리고 나는 확실하지 않았다.

TeamViewer는 어떤 프로토콜을 사용합니까? VNC 및 RDP와 비슷합니다. 그러나 나는 그것에 대한 많은 정보를 찾을 수없는 것 같습니다.


답변:


24

TeamViewer는 고유 한 프로토콜을 사용합니다. 인증 계층이 부분적으로 분석되었지만 문서화되지 않았습니다.

RDP 또는 VNC (RFB)와 비슷하지만 NAT 통과를 포함하고 약간 다른 인증 방법 (일회성 PIN)이 있으며 파일 전송 및 채팅을 지원하며 네트워크 조건에 동적으로 적응합니다.


2
RDP 및 VNC와 달리 연결을 설정하는 서버가 있으므로 P2P가 아니므로 NAT 통과가 가능해야합니다.
paradroid

주로 피어 투 피어입니다. 상당수의 프로토콜 (예 : MS 이전 Skype)은 데이터 릴레이가 아닌 NAT 홀 펀칭에만 순수하게 중앙 노드를 사용합니다.
user1686

NAT traversal / hole punching 부분에 대해 자세히 설명해 주시겠습니까?
목소리
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.